>From 5c417db4ba2fd13091067104e5afe4554750be11 Mon Sep 17 00:00:00 2001
From: Ming Lei <ming....@canonical.com>
Date: Tue, 2 Oct 2012 13:46:56 +0800
Subject: [PATCH] usbnet: make device out of suspend before calling
 usbnet_read/write_cmd

This patche gets the runtime PM reference count before calling
usb_control_msg, and puts it after completion of the
usb_control_msg, so that the usb control message can always be
sent to one active device.
